MRI Examining the body without radiation.

Magnetic resonance imaging (MRI), also known as MRI utilizes magnetic fields and radiofrequency technology rather than ionizing radiation to create detailed images. MRI is particularly useful for viewing various types of organs, soft tissues, joints, and other internal structures. Patients suffering from joint pain, for instance, may require more information than what can be gathered using a standard Xray.

CT Creates Detailed Cross-Sectional Views

The method by which computed tomography utilizes imaging is different. CT uses X Rays as well as computer processing to create an image of the cross-sectional body to produce detailed images. CT produces a slice-by-slice image of the internal anatomy, providing doctors with a different method to answer certain medical queries.

The common X-ray plays an important function to play

The traditional radiography is not obsolete. Digital X-ray diagnostics can provide images rapidly and are useful for a variety of tests, especially when physicians need to evaluate bones and structures. Digital systems that are modern also require less radiation than older techniques.

Sometimes, the most complex test isn’t the most appropriate one. The most effective way to diagnose is by selecting methods according to the clinical issue not only the most modern equipment.

Breast Imaging Has Its Own Particularized Technology

Mammography is a diagnostic tool specifically designed for breast cancer. The Wolfsburg Diagnostic Center also provides 3D mammography (also called tomosynthesis) in addition to conventional mammography. The technology creates multiple images that can then be reconstructed to create a layered image of breast tissue. Specialized imaging matters because various areas of the body present different diagnostic challenges.
